At AAA, our Team Members strive to deliver amazing service and help our Members live life more confidently by delivering to them amazing service and a portfolio of outstanding products that benefit them. In doing so, we align with our True North vision of creating Members for life.

NOTE: This role is hybrid and requires 3 days a week in our Walnut Creek, CA office.

As the Senior, UX Researcher, you will synthesize data from Member feedback, competitive analysis, product demos, collaboration with product managers and business lines, and insights from industry experts. This is not a designer role, but familiarity with design principles is crucial to understanding user challenges and articulating actionable solutions. The role provides guidance, reviews findings, and delivers strategic recommendations to address pain points, enhance AAA Member value, and improve the overall Member experience.

RESPONSIBILITIES / JOB DUTIES

  • Analyze real-world usage data and behavioral analytics to inform customer Experience optimization strategies.
    • Conduct generative user experience research, including ethnographic studies, user interviews, and usability testing, to identify gaps and opportunities within the customer journey and design initiatives that improve engagement and satisfaction.
    • Review and synthesize qualitative and quantitative data to produce actionable insights and strategic recommendations.
    • Develop and maintain user personas, journey maps, and service blueprints.
    • Create compelling documentation and presentations to communicate research findings and recommendations.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to influence product direction and strategy based on research findings.
    • Facilitate workshops, design sprints, and stakeholder meetings; skillfully incorporate feedback and align cross-functional teams around key findings.
    • Advocate for a human centered design approach that fosters a culture of empathy and understanding of customer needs.
  • Stay informed about marketplace trends, competitor dynamics, and customer feedback, translating these insights into actionable recommendations.
